Examples of org.apache.ws.security.message.WSSecEncrypt.addInternalRefElement()


       
        /*
         * We use this method because we want the reference list to be inside the
         * EncryptedKey element
         */
        builder.addInternalRefElement(refs);

        /*
         * now add (prepend) the EncryptedKey element, then a
         * BinarySecurityToken if one was setup during prepare
         */
